FURTHER STIPULATION TO CONTINUE CASE MANANGEMENT CONFERENCE AND STAY DISCOVERY AND LITIGATION PENDING FINALIZATION OF TENTATIVE SETTLEMENT AND PROPOSED ORDER

THELTON E. HENDERSON, District Judge.

The undersigned, the attorneys for the parties herein, hereby stipulate as follows:

That they have participated in good faith in four all day settlement conferences with Magistrate Judge Laurel Beeler on June 18, July 3, and September 26, 2012 and January 25, 2013, one two hour settlement conference with Judge Beeler on March 22, 2013, as well as several telephone conferences with Judge Beeler;

That on the afternoon of January 25, 2013, the parties reached a tentative agreement on the amount of plaintiffs' monetary claims;

That the monetary terms of the agreement have been approved by the Oakland City Council and the Alameda County Board of Supervisors, but the agreement is also contingent upon the parties reaching agreement on the plaintiffs' injunctive relief claims;

That, in order to give the parties time to further negotiate settlement, they jointly request that the Court continue the case management conference currently set for April 8, 2013 to May 13, 2013 at 1:30 p.m., or such later date as the Court may choose. Magistrate Judge Laurel Beeler has set a further settlement conference for April 4, 2013 at 1:30 p.m.

ORDER

GOOD CAUSE appearing therefor, and the parties having so stipulated, it is herby ordered that the case management conference presently scheduled for April 8, 2013 at 1:30 p.m. is continued to May 13, 2013 at 1:30 p.m. The parties shall file a joint case management conference statement on or before May 6, 2013. It is further ordered that all discovery and other litigation in this matter shall remain stayed until after May 13, 2013.

IT IS SO ORDERED.
